Umm Al Sheif is an established villa district close to Sheikh Zayed Road, made up mainly of independent villas on individually owned plots rather than the single master-planned, gated structure found in a Nakheel or Emaar community. That distinction matters for renovation, since there is generally no single owners association setting a common design guideline for the whole neighbourhood, and villa ages and layouts vary more from plot to plot than they would in a uniform master-planned development. Kitchen renovation in Umm Al Sheif ranges from updating a kitchen fitted within the last several years to replacing one that has never been substantially renovated since the villa was built. We check the condition of water supply lines, drainage and electrical circuits behind the kitchen during the site visit regardless of the stated age of the property, since an independent villa may have had prior renovations that are not obvious from a general condition assessment, and we price any needed system work as a distinct line item.
Bathroom renovation here includes a waterproofing check before any retiling as standard practice, since villa age and renovation history vary enough in this district that we do not assume a membrane is either fine or failing without checking it directly. We also assess supply and drainage pipework condition, and where a household wants an upgraded feature such as a larger shower enclosure or additional vanity, we confirm supply capacity in advance.
Flooring replacement in Umm Al Sheif villas often involves removing older tile, marble or timber flooring and correcting the subfloor before laying a new porcelain, natural stone-look tile or engineered hardwood finish. Painting is usually part of a broader refresh, and we check for any signs of past water ingress or damp before repainting, particularly relevant in an independent villa where the renovation history may not be fully documented.
As independently owned villas on individual plots, Umm Al Sheif properties often have more structural flexibility for layout changes and extensions than a unit in a tightly regulated master-planned community, though any change affecting a load-bearing wall still needs a structural assessment, and any extension or exterior change needs a Dubai Municipality permit. Common requests include reconfiguring an existing layout, adding a room where plot space allows, or updating an older extension that was added some years after the original build. We assess structural feasibility and confirm plot boundary and permit requirements during the site visit before including any layout change in a project scope.
A full villa renovation in Umm Al Sheif brings kitchen, bathroom, flooring, painting, layout changes and any electrical or plumbing upgrades together into one coordinated project. This is often the most practical approach for an independent villa that has been owned for many years and where several systems or finishes are due for attention at once. We scope full renovations room by room during the site visit, including a check of what has already been updated at some point in the property history and what has not.
Material choices for Umm Al Sheif renovations vary by household and by the existing character of the specific villa, since properties here were built and updated independently rather than to a single community specification. Porcelain and natural stone-look large-format tile are popular for living areas, engineered hardwood adds warmth to bedrooms, and stone or quartz countertops are a common upgrade for kitchens and bathrooms. We bring samples to the site visit so material decisions can be made against the actual layout, light and existing finishes of that specific villa.
Cosmetic interior work such as painting, flooring and internal fixture replacement generally does not require formal approval in Umm Al Sheif. Because this district does not sit within a single master-planned owners association, structural changes, extensions and any exterior-visible alterations are generally approved directly through Dubai Municipality rather than a community design review body, which is a more direct process than in a gated master-planned community but still requires proper documentation and sign-off before work begins. We identify which permit applies during the site visit and manage the submission as part of the project.

A partial upgrade in Umm Al Sheif, such as a kitchen or bathroom refresh with no system replacement needed, generally runs over a few weeks once materials are confirmed. A project that also includes system replacement, layout changes or an extension takes longer, since Dubai Municipality permit approval needs to complete before affected work can begin. We build a realistic permit and system-condition allowance into the schedule from the outset, since villa history in this district is more individually variable than in a uniform master-planned community. Material lead time for imported finishes is the other common variable, so we recommend confirming selections early.
